Term:EC 1.3.1.8 [acyl-CoA dehydrogenase (NADP(+))] inhibitor
go back to main search page
Accession:CHEBI:78377 term browser browse the term
Definition:An EC 1.3.1.* (oxidoreductase acting on donor CH-CH group, NAD(+) or NADP(+) as acceptor) inhibitor that interferes with the action of acyl-CoA dehydrogenase (NADP(+)), EC 1.3.1.8.
